
Carissa Broadbent is best known for her Crowns of Nyaxia series, which became an instant sensation in 2022. But two years before that success, she published a completely different trilogy: The War of Lost Hearts.
This romantasy series follows Tisaanah, a former slave fighting for her freedom, only to realize freedom comes with a price. To truly be free, she must earn her place among the Orders, the most powerful organizations of magic Wielders in the world. That means completing an apprenticeship and binding herself to the Orders’ will, especially if she wants to save the friends she left behind.
The first book, Daughter of No Worlds was originally released in 2020 with a striking cover of Tisaanah in her iconic fiery red dress, which is a pivotal scene in the story. We love that original design, but the new cover? It perfectly captures the eerie, almost sentient undertones that take hold in the second half of the book—an element that changes everything once it enters the story (no spoilers!)
Daughter of No Worlds delivers what we’ve come to expect from Carissa Broadbent: a beautifully tense slow-burn romance, layered with vulnerability, and yearning. The magic system feels very fresh and creative, opening the door for further conversations about moral complexity and the worst side of humanity. The political intrigue is a bit on the less-developed side but with two more books to go, we are very excited to explore more in the next instalments.
